4. Inspiration. Fuel for the Mind

The EcoLeader of tomorrow thrives on inspiration. Whether through reading, podcasts, or creative exploration. Inspiration is the spark that fuels your drive, keeping your mind active and engaged.

But here is a powerful addition to your morning: write three Morning Pages, a practice from Julia Cameron’s The Artist’s Way. These three pages are non-negotiable. They clear your mind and teach you that your mood does not matter. Whether you feel motivated or sluggish, the practice remains. It is not about waiting for the perfect moment or feeling. It’s about showing up every day, no matter what. For the procrastinators and uncertain, Morning Pages will unlock a deeper clarity and break through self-doubt.

In this simple act, you will find the strength to start and the courage to create.
